Management companies may keep all, part of, or none of income associated with returned check fees, rental income for pets, lease violation fees, unpaid invoice fees, bill payment fees, or income from laundry or vending machines.When assessing a property management company, make sure to ask specific questions about their fee structure and the services included.

Set policies, put them in writing, commit them to memory, and do not waive them:All adults must pass your screening;Nobody moves in without proof utility accounts are established, rent and deposit are paid in full;Rent is due on or before the 1st, period.Late fee is applied on day X, period.3-day Notice to Pay or Quit is filed on day X, period.Eviction filing (forcible entry and detainer) is filed on day X, period.Be prepared to handle lease violations (unauthorized pets or tenants, vehicle parked on lawn, not mowing grass, etc.)A little education and preparation will go a long way.
